Cyclones/Filter Heads

 

Sterling's cyclones are designed
for efficiency and performance.
Featuring 14 gauge steel and angle
iron ring construction, manufactured
to fit the customer’s needs.


The proper cyclone size is essential in
your material handling system. Sterling’s
cyclones are available in capacities
ranging from 300 to over 15,000 CFM.
The innovative spiralcone design helps
prevent bridging at the cone collar
associated with troublesome low-density
materials.


We offer a complete list of options in
order to provide precisely the type of
cyclone required in your operation.
Available Options:
 Stainless Steel construction
 Support stand
 Side Mounted Filter Head
 Top Mounted Filter Head
 Spiral Breaker Strip - eliminates bridging at the cone collar
 Rectangular inlet (round is standard)
 Multi-inlets
 Dampered inlets
 Clean-out door in cone or body
 Flanged inlet and/or cone collar
 Storm Damper
 Take-off Cap
